About Emanuela Tolosano
Emanuela Tolosano is a scholar working on Genetics, Cell Biology and Molecular Biology, having authored 106 papers that have together received 4.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Heme Oxygenase-1 and Carbon Monoxide (35 papers), Hemoglobin structure and function (19 papers) and Neonatal Health and Biochemistry (18 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Genetics (965 citations), Hematology (850 citations) and Cell Biology (847 citations). Emanuela Tolosano has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Fiorella Altruda, Francesca Vinchi, Deborah Chiabrando, Veronica Fiorito, Lorenzo Silengo, Sharmila Fagoonee, Sara Petrillo, Emilio Hirsch, Giada Ingoglia and Martina U. Muckenthaler.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Circulation and Journal of Clinical Investigation.
